Leasing Options To Sponsor PL Kicks Programme

9 November 2021

Leasing Options will sponsor Preston North End Community and Education Trust’s [PNECET] Premier League Kicks programme, providing free football sessions for eight to 18-year-olds in Preston, as part of its recently agreed partnership with Preston North End Football Club.

Thanks to the support of Leasing Options, the UK’s leading car leasing company, more PL Kicks sessions will be delivered by PNECET every week while covering more wards across Preston.

New sessions will be delivered in partnership with the Community Gateway Association in a new ward of Preston.

Leasing Options branding will now appear on all PL Kicks bibs worn by participants within sessions and on PNECET social media posts relating to the Kicks programme.

PNECET Head of Community Engagement Rebecca Robertson said: “We’re really excited to be expanding our PL Kicks programme and offering more opportunities for young people to access free football sessions across Preston.

“The support from Leasing Options is absolutely fantastic and will allow us to provide our participants with new equipment while delivering further sessions in Preston and reach young people who might not previously have accessed our provision.

“We aim to create safer, stronger and more resilient communities through the power of the Preston North End brand across our provision, and we will be only helped in doing that by reaching more young people across Preston through our expanded PL Kicks offer.

“We’re extremely thankful to Leasing Options for their support and look forward to working together more on our Kicks offer going forward.”

Mike Thompson, chief operating officer at Leasing Options added: “Supporting grassroots sports is really important to us and we’re delighted to be sponsoring the incredible work Preston North End Community and Education Trust’s (PNECET) Premier League Kicks programme does and to be able to help extend it to even more young people across Preston.”
